The 2024 Conejo Valley Parade is Back After 11 Years!

After a long hiatus of 11 years, the Conejo Valley Parade made a triumphant return this past weekend, and Signature Signs was thrilled to play a part in this beloved community event. Known for its vibrant history and cherished traditions, the parade once again adorned Thousand Oaks Boulevard, drawing crowds eager to partake in the festivities and celebrate the "good old days" of our area.

Organized by the Rotary Club of Westlake Village Sunrise and Fargo’s Angels, led by Wendy MacLeod, this year's parade was a spectacular showcase of local heritage and community spirit. Featuring a range of entries from vintage cars and majestic horses to celebrity appearances and historical salutes, the event seamlessly blended tradition with modern-day enthusiasm.

Among the highlights was the poignant tribute to the late Brett Taylor, remembered as "Brother Brett," who was honored as the parade's grand marshal with a riderless horse and a missing man formation flyover by the Condor Squadron. The parade’s theme, “Good Old Days,” was not just a nod to nostalgia but a celebration of the resilience and enduring spirit of Conejo Valley. From the Jungleland USA tribute featuring an actress as the famed lion trainer Mabel Stark, to performances by local schools and community groups, the parade was a vibrant tribute to our collective heritage.
